Make mine the 6-jugger. Might even decrease the amount of pure in your WW, or even eliminate it entirely. WW at 12 BHN should still expand, might likely group better, and poke a little deeper.

Yep, mine too! I shot a mule buck with the 245 grain boolit cast of COWW +2% tin last year. He staggered 3 steps sideways and went down for good. Double lung shot , only hit one rib. Lungs were devastated.
